Home » How Much Storage Space and Bandwidth Do I Need for My Website?

How Much Storage Space and Bandwidth Do I Need for My Website?

by Bradley
How much storage space and bandwidth do I need for my website

When planning your website, determining how much storage space and bandwidth you need is crucial. These two factors directly affect your site’s performance and user experience. Overestimating can lead to unnecessary costs, while underestimating can cause slowdowns or outages. Here’s a detailed guide to help you calculate the right requirements for your website.

What Is Storage Space?

Storage space refers to the amount of disk space allocated on your web hosting server to store your website’s files. This includes:

  • HTML, CSS, and JavaScript files
  • Images and videos
  • Databases
  • Emails (if email hosting is included)

Factors That Influence Storage Space Requirements

1. Type of Website: A basic blog or portfolio site may only need 1-2 GB, while an e-commerce site with high-resolution images and a large database could require 10 GB or more.

2. Media Usage: Websites heavy on images, videos, or downloadable files will need significantly more storage.

3. Growth Plans: If you plan to expand your website in the future, choose a hosting plan with scalable storage options.

What Is Bandwidth?

Bandwidth is the amount of data transferred between your website and its visitors over a specific period. It is typically measured in gigabytes (GB) per month. Bandwidth affects:

  • How many visitors your site can handle
  • How quickly your site loads during peak traffic

Factors That Influence Bandwidth Requirements

1. Traffic Volume: A website with 1,000 monthly visitors will require far less bandwidth than one with 100,000 visitors.

2. Page Size: Larger pages with high-resolution images or videos consume more bandwidth per visitor.

3. Visitor Behavior: Sites with high engagement, such as users downloading files or streaming videos, need more bandwidth.

How to Calculate Your Needs

Use the following formula to estimate your bandwidth requirements:

Bandwidth = Average Page Size (in MB) × Monthly Visitors × Average Page Views per Visitor

For example:

  • Average Page Size: 2 MB
  • Monthly Visitors: 5,000
  • Page Views per Visitor: 3

Bandwidth: 2 × 5,000 × 3 = 30,000 MB (or 30 GB per month)

Common Recommendations

Small Websites: If you’re running a blog, personal site, or portfolio, 1-5 GB of storage and 10-20 GB of bandwidth per month is usually sufficient.

Medium-Sized Websites: For small business sites or moderately trafficked blogs, 5-20 GB of storage and 50-100 GB of bandwidth is recommended.

Large Websites: E-commerce stores or high-traffic websites may require 50 GB or more of storage and over 500 GB of bandwidth per month.

Scalable Hosting Plans

If you’re unsure about your exact needs, choose a hosting provider that offers scalable plans. This ensures you can increase storage or bandwidth as your site grows without experiencing downtime or switching providers.

Conclusion

Understanding your website’s storage and bandwidth needs is key to selecting the right hosting plan. By evaluating your website’s type, media usage, and traffic expectations, you can avoid overpaying for resources you don’t need or experiencing performance issues from insufficient resources. Always opt for scalable hosting solutions to accommodate future growth.

You may also like

Leave a Comment